Deep Tide TechFlow message: On June 08, according to Caixin.com, the UK High Court held a procedural hearing on June 5 regarding the disposal of assets related to the Qian Zhiming case. Concerning roughly 60,000 bitcoins and other assets involved in the case, about 16,000 Chinese victims have already registered through multiple UK law firms to participate in the civil recovery proceedings under the UK Proceeds of Crime Act.



The registration window for May 22 has closed. These roughly 16,000 people essentially constitute the current scope of victims eligible to enter the UK civil recovery proceedings. Compared with the Blue Sky Grey case’s 128,000 victims, those who have entered the UK proceedings account for less than 13%, and because there may be duplicate registrations, further deduplication will still be required.
